Technological Innovations Shaping Japan Aerosolized Iron Silicon Chromium Powder Market

Technological advancements are central to Japan’s aerosolized powder industry, with a focus on improving particle uniformity, purity, and dispersibility. Innovations in plasma atomization and gas atomization techniques enable the production of ultra-fine, high-purity powders essential for high-performance applications. The integration of AI and machine learning in process optimization is also gaining traction, leading to enhanced quality control and reduced production costs.

Nanotechnology is revolutionizing the industry by enabling the creation of powders with tailored surface properties, improving adhesion and corrosion resistance. Additionally, environmentally friendly production methods, such as energy-efficient atomization processes and waste minimization, are gaining importance due to Japan’s stringent environmental policies. These technological trends not only improve product performance but also open avenues for new applications in emerging sectors like quantum computing and advanced electronics, positioning Japan as a leader in aerosolized metallic powders innovation.
